So my shop renter moved out and I am in the middle of re-insulating my entire shop due to a raccoon infestation last winter(man they are destructive). I am setting up my dedicated build area for my KR2S. I have 24x30 area set aside for the build and was wondering what you guys have found as a life saver or great ideas you could not live without while building. I have great lighting, plenty of bench space, heat and cooling, two 220v outlets and 10 or so 110v outlets beer fridge and great sound system. What have you found to be real handy or something maybe you would have done differently if you could have set up your area from scratch? I figure I have the chance before I really dig into this build so I might as well make any changes now. Let's hear those "man I wish I would have's" or the "I'm really glad I did's".
